Inspecting a Truck Before Making a Purchase
When inspecting a truck before making a purchase, it’s essential to carefully examine both the mechanical and exterior components. This will help you identify any potential issues or problems that may affect the truck’s performance and reliability. Here are some key areas to inspect:
-
Exterior
Inspect the truck’s body and paintwork for any signs of damage or wear. Check the tires for proper inflation and tread depth. Also, look for any signs of rust or corrosion on the chassis and other metal components. -
Interior
Inspect the interior of the truck for any signs of wear or damage. Check the seats, dashboard, and carpets for any stains or tears. Also, test the lights, radio, and other electrical components to ensure they are functioning properly. -
Mechanical Components
Inspect the engine, transmission, and other mechanical components to ensure they are in good working order. Check for any signs of leaks or damage to the fluids, belts, and hoses. Also, test the brakes and suspension to ensure they are functioning properly.
Considering Financing Options for Your New Truck: Cheap Trucks For Sale Near Me

When buying a new truck, one of the most crucial aspects to consider is financing. Financing is a way to pay for your truck over time, and it can save you a significant amount of money upfront. However, it’s essential to carefully review the terms and conditions of any financing agreement to ensure you’re getting the best deal.
Excluding personal savings, there are three primary financing options for buying a truck: loans, leases, and dealer financing. Each option has its pros and cons, and you should evaluate them thoroughly to make an informed decision.
Loan Financing Options
Loans are the most common financing option for buying a truck. You can opt for a secured loan, where the truck itself serves as collateral, or an unsecured loan, which typically has higher interest rates. Consider the following loan options:
- A Secured Car Loan: This type of loan is guaranteed by the truck you’re purchasing.
- An Unsecured Car Loan: You may need to provide additional collateral or meet specific income requirements for this type of loan.
- A Co-Signer Car Loan: Having a co-signer with good credit can help you qualify for a lower interest rate.
Keep in mind that secured loans usually have lower interest rates and more favorable terms. However, you risk losing your truck if you fail to make payments.
Leasing Options
Leasing is another financing option where you rent a truck for a specified period, usually 2-3 years. At the end of the lease, you can return the truck or purchase it at a predetermined price. Leasing can be a cost-effective option, but you won’t own the truck outright.
- Open-End Leases: You’re responsible for the difference between the truck’s actual value and the lease’s end value, known as the “residual” or “balloon payment.” This can be a risk if the truck’s value depreciates significantly.
- Closed-End Leases: The lessee is not responsible for the residual value, as it’s capped or guaranteed by the leasing company.
Dealer Financing Options
Some dealerships offer financing options through their networks of lenders. While these options might be convenient, they often come with higher interest rates and less flexible terms.
Remember, financing options and rates vary depending on your credit score, income, location, and other factors. Always review the fine print, understand the terms and conditions, and calculate the total cost of ownership, including interest, to ensure you’re making the best decision for your financial situation.
Funding your truck through a reputable lender or bank is generally a safer option, as you’re often offered lower interest rates and more favorable terms.
Preparing for the Purchase and Ownership of a Budget-Friendly Truck

When buying a budget-friendly truck, it’s crucial to be aware of the associated costs beyond the initial purchase price. This includes fuel, maintenance, and insurance expenses, which can significantly impact your overall budget. Ignoring these costs can result in financial strain and affect your quality of life.
Owning a truck comes with a range of expenses that you should be aware of before making a purchase. These include:
Understanding the Costs of Truck Ownership
The costs of owning a truck can be substantial, and it’s essential to consider them before making a purchase. Fuel costs will vary depending on the type of truck, fuel efficiency, and how frequently you use it. Additionally, maintenance costs, such as replacements for brake pads, oil changes, and tire rotations, can add up over time. Insurance premiums will also depend on the truck’s value, safety features, and your driving record. Considering these costs can help you make an informed decision when buying a budget-friendly truck.
Saving Money on Truck Ownership
There are several ways to save money on truck ownership, starting with fuel efficiency. Choosing a truck with good fuel economy can significantly reduce fuel costs. Some models may also offer features such as automatic start/stop technology or eco-mode, which can help improve fuel efficiency. Furthermore, regular maintenance can prevent costly repairs down the line. For instance, changing the oil regularly can help extend the life of the engine and prevent damage.
Safety Features to Look for in a Budget-Friendly Truck, Cheap trucks for sale near me
When purchasing a budget-friendly truck, it’s essential to look for safety features that can protect you and your passengers in the event of an accident. Some key safety features to consider include:
- Airbags: Multiple airbags can help protect against serious injury or death in the event of a crash.
- Anti-lock brakes (ABS): ABS helps prevent wheels from locking up during hard braking, improving stopping power and reducing the risk of skidding or losing control.
- Traction control: Traction control helps prevent wheelspin during takeoff or acceleration on slippery surfaces, reducing the risk of losing control.
Safety features like these can provide added peace of mind and protection while driving a truck. It’s worth noting that some countries have specific regulations regarding the mandatory installation of certain safety features in vehicles.
It’s also worth checking if the truck you’re interested in has a good crash test rating, which can help ensure your safety on the road.
